Social participation, such as having interpersonal interactions and participation in community activities contribute to a high level of quality of life for the elderly. However, an effective way to promote social participation has not been fully established. Conventional service recommendation technologies have several limitations including no consideration of one's health status, no transport arrangement and no consideration of one's feelings. In this study, we proposed new service recommendation system which is consist of two functions. One is to recommend a service which takes into account the status of a service usage and experiences service users had in the past. The other function is to create a plan for a day using multiple social services available in a community. We used the developed system in Minamisoma-city, Fukushima, Japan and evaluated its usefulness.
